Russian troops attack Dnipropetrovsk region more than 50 times since morning, injuring three people

Ukrinform
Throughout the day, Russian forces carried out more than 50 attacks on the Nikopol and Synelnykove districts of the Dnipropetrovsk region, leaving three people wounded.

The head of the Dnipropetrovsk Regional Military Administration, Oleksandr Hanzha, reported this on Telegram, according to Ukrinform.

The enemy used artillery, drones, and also carried out an airstrike with a guided bomb.

In the Nikopol district, Russians targeted the district center as well as the Chervonohryhorivka, Pokrovske, Marhanets, and Myrove communities.

Apartment buildings, private homes, a gas station, and vehicles were damaged. Two men, aged 58 and 67, were injured.

In the Synelnykove district, Russian troops struck the Pokrovske and Dubovykivka communities.

A private house and a non-operational building were damaged. A 68-year-old man was injured and hospitalized in moderate condition.

As Ukrinform previously reported, late in the evening of May 18, Russians attacked facilities belonging to the Naftogaz Group in the Dnipropetrovsk region with three ballistic missiles.
